Cape Town – It’s official — love is in the air and sealed in tradition! Media powerhouse Anele Mdoda has officially said “I do” to Bonelela “Buzza” James, a prominent lawyer and royal from the AbaThembu tribe, according to reports.
The couple celebrated their union in a private, traditional Xhosa ceremony attended by close family and friends.
The intimate affair was rich with cultural flair, capturing the essence of their heritage.
Photos from the ceremony soon made their way online, sparking waves of excitement and warm wishes across social media. Notable guests, including Anele’s close friend and author Khaya Dlanga, shared glimpses of the beautiful day.
Speculation about their relationship had been growing since 2024, especially after Anele was spotted wearing a sparkling ring at The Last Ranger screening in Johannesburg and again at the Oscars.
